Ordinance 42798

Introduced as Council Bill 32291

Title

An Ordinance providing for the improvement of 39th Avenue North, from East Madison Street to East Newton Street Produced; 38th Avenue North, from East Howe Street to East Newton Street Produced; East Garfield Street, from 39th Avenue North to East Madison Street; and East Blaine Street and East Howe Street, each from 38th Avenue North to 39th Avenue North; all in The City of Seattle all in accordance with Resolution No. 6806 of the City Council of the City of Seattle, creating a local improvement district therefor, and providing that payment of said improvement be made by special assessments upon property in said district payable by mode of "Payment by Bonds".
